Stack Delivery Operation

Trailing edges of the sheets stacked in the processing tray unit are gripped by driving the
gripper base motor (M116) and gripper motor (M117), and the paper stack is delivered to the
stacking tray.
When the stack consists of 10 or fewer sheets as long as or shorter than 216 mm or it
consists of two or fewer sheets longer than 216 mm, sheets gripped by the gripper are
delivered faster than usual.

Swing Height Detection Control

The height of the sheets stacked in the processing tray is detected by the swing height
detection sensor (S118) and the height of the swing unit is adjusted appropriately (during
stacking of a sheet in the processing tray) to lessen the damages (scratches, etc.) to the
image due to abrasion between the previously stacked sheet and the newly delivered sheet.
